Be the first one at gate. Hit up gift shop first, ship it fed ex, and get it out of the way for the day. Go put chairs down somewhere to come back to rest. Then just walk. Very hilly. There is something to see every hole.

We usually post up behind 8 Tee box. Its kinda in middle of course and can get around to see a lot of holes. It is also close to concession and bathrooms. Use apple watches to communicate with friends.

Best sporting event ever. It is just so well run. We have been every year since 2019 (except covid obviously). I'll be there Tuesday thru Thursday this year. See you there!

I went last year for the first time. It was the most wonderful experience of my life in sports.

Bring a chair with no arms. You can buy one (and I would later in the day) first thing in the morning, but that line is LONG and the good spots will be taken. I suggest that you walk your chair to number 2 behind the green or 70 yards from 13, where the players have to lay up in front of Rey’s creek or go for the green. Put your name on the back of your chair, put it down, and walk the course. No one will touch or move your chair.

The course is perfect. Concessions are cheap. Bathrooms are every where and it’s super clean. Walk with some player groups, but go to your chair when the ‘big boys’ play thru. It’s a tough course to walk in some places, especially walking up 18 or 9.

Good places to watch are in the bleachers. They are open to any patron. Augusta National doesn’t have special sections for the well-heeled like most tournaments.

Beers are cheap too. But don’t get drunk. Just enjoy the day. 16 tee box stands. See all of 16, green of 15, tee box of 17. Lots of good golf. Fills up early. Get souvenirs. They aren’t crazy high either.

Most over hyped event in sports .... until you experience it. It's everything you've heard about and then some. Simply incredible and for all of the "pretentiousness", it's anything but during the tournament as long as you behave yourself. (good call on the cell phone, just leave it behind)

Not sure there's anything to "see" in particular but my routine -
- get there early and walk the course 1 to 18 just to square up what you've been watching on TV in 2D with 3D (it's some how even better). Along the way get an egg salad sandwich for 'breakfast" and drink of your choice (beer for me)
- turn around and walk it 18 to 1 to see it coming into the hole and begin to watch some players come through. Pick up a pimento cheese for "lunch" along the way.
- from there you know the course, where the best spots are, eats and bathrooms and have at it. I never got a "spot" just wandered to various holes and groups for 8+ hours. Those yeast rolls and butter will never taste better .... if you can get in.
